Geraldine "Jere" Gilbert Eisenhaur's Obituary
CLAUDE SERVICES- 2:00 pm on Saturday, March 29, 2008 in the United Methodist Church in Claude with Rev. Janet Edwards, Pastor, & Rev. Gene Weinette, Pastor of the First United Methodist Church in Stratford, officiating. INTERMENT - Claude Cemetery in Claude. Geraldine “Jere” Gilbert Eisenhaur was born August 3, 1933 to Josephine and Jack Gilbert in Claude, Armstrong County, Texas. She was the youngest granddaughter of Lula and Miles Oliver and Alice and Charles Gilbert early settlers of Armstrong County. She had always been proud to be a native of Claude. She married Charles D. Eisenhaur on September 1, 1949 in Pampa, Texas. They worked together in the trucking and custom harvesting business until his illness and death in May 1994. Together they raised two children. Since Charles’ death her life has been consumed by her four important passions: Her Lord, her grandchildren, her great grandchildren, and her Navajo family. She was adopted into the Honigahni Clan in October 1999. She had strived to follow Jesus' example by reaching out, loving her neighbor, appreciating her heritage, & being committed to her church. She was proud of her town of Claude. PRECEDED IN DEATH BY- her husband, in 1994; her daughter, Lindy Jo in 1964; her father in 1953; her mother in 1990; and a beloved cousin, Wilbur Cobb in 2003.
